
无论是金融机构、医疗机构、教育机构还是各类企业,数据的安全性和完整性都是业务连续性和客户信任的基础
面对日益复杂的网络威胁和不可预测的自然灾害,如何确保数据的安全存储和快速恢复,成为了每个组织必须面对的重要课题
在这其中,自动备份机制无疑是一道坚实的防线,而MDF(主数据文件)和LDF(日志文件)作为SQL Server数据库的核心组成部分,其备份策略更是重中之重
一、认识MDF与LDF:数据库的双保险 在深入探讨自动备份之前,我们先来了解一下MDF和LDF文件的基本概念及其重要性
- MDF(Primary Data File,主数据文件):MDF文件是SQL Server数据库中存储实际数据的主要文件
它包含了表的定义、索引、存储过程、视图等所有数据库对象的物理数据
简而言之,MDF文件是数据库的“心脏”,没有它,数据库就失去了存在的意义
- LDF(Log File,日志文件):LDF文件记录了数据库中所有事务的历史记录,包括数据修改、插入、删除等操作
这些日志信息对于数据库的完整性至关重要,因为它们允许系统在发生故障时进行事务回滚或重做,确保数据库恢复到一致状态
LDF文件就像是数据库的“记忆”,记录着每一次改变,确保每一步操作都能被追踪和恢复
MDF与LDF相辅相成,共同构成了SQL Server数据库的稳定基石
因此,针对这两类文件的自动备份策略,不仅关乎数据的即时恢复能力,更是企业数据保护策略的核心
二、自动备份的必要性:预防胜于救灾 在数据保护领域,有一个被广泛接受的原则——“3-2-1备份规则”:即至少拥有3份数据副本,其中2份存储在不同类型的存储介质上,至少有1份位于异地
这一规则强调了数据备份的多样性、冗余性和地理分散性,而自动备份机制则是实现这一目标的有效手段
1.减少人为错误:手动备份过程繁琐且易出错,如忘记备份、备份文件损坏或丢失等
自动备份系统能够按照预设的时间表自动执行备份任务,大大降低了人为因素导致的风险
2.即时响应突发事件:自然灾害、硬件故障、恶意攻击等突发事件可能随时发生,自动备份能够确保在第一时间捕获数据的最新状态,为快速恢复提供可能
3.提升业务连续性:对于依赖数据库运行的企业而言,数据中断意味着服务停滞和收入损失
自动备份缩短了恢复时间目标(RTO)和恢复点目标(RPO),确保业务能在最短时间内恢复正常运行
4.合规性要求:许多行业(如金融、医疗)对数据保护和备份有严格的法律法规要求
自动备份机制能够帮助企业满足这些合规性要求,避免法律风险
三、MDF与LDF的自动备份策略 实施有效的MDF与LDF自动备份策略,需要综合考虑备份类型、存储位置、备份频率、监控与报警等多个方面
1.全备份与差异备份/事务日志备份: -全备份:定期对整个数据库进行完整复制,是恢复的基础
虽然全备份占用空间大且耗时,但它是确保数据完整性的关键
-差异备份:记录自上次全备份以来所有发生变化的数据
相比全备份,差异备份更加高效,但恢复时需要结合全备份和最后一次差异备份
-事务日志备份:针对LDF文件,记录每个事务的详细信息
在需要精确到某个时间点恢复时,事务日志备份尤为重要
结合使用这三种备份类型,可以在保证数据恢复精度的同时,优化备份效率
例如,可以每日进行全备份,每小时进行差异备份或事务日志备份,具体策略需根据数据库大小、变化频率和业务需求灵活调整
2.存储位置与冗余设计: - 备份文件应存储在不同于生产数据库的存储介质上,以减少单点故障风险
可以考虑使用网络附加存储(NAS)、存储区域网络(SAN)或云存储服务
- 实施异地备份,确保在本地发生灾难时,仍有备份数据可用
云备份服务因其便捷性和成本效益,成为越来越多企业的选择
3.备份频率与窗口: - 备份频率应根据数据变化速度、业务容忍的数据丢失量以及系统资源使用情况来确定
例如,对于交易频繁、数据价值高的系统,可能需要更频繁的备份
- 合理安排备份时间窗口,避免影响业务高峰期操作
利用夜间或低峰时段进行备份,可以最小化对业务的影响
4.监控与报警: - 实施备份作业监控,确保每次备份任务都能成功完成
利用SQL Server自带的SQL Server Agent或第三方工具,可以实时监控备份状态
- 配置报警机制,当备份失败或存储空间不足时,及时通知管理员
这有助于快速响应问题,避免数据丢失风险
5.测试恢复流程: - 定期测试备份数据的恢复流程,验证备份的有效性和恢复策略的有效性
这不仅包括数据文件的恢复,还应包括应用程序的测试,确保整个系统能够顺利重启
- 记录恢复过程中的每一步,形成标准化的恢复文档,以便在真正需要时快速执行
四、结语:构建数据安全的坚固防线 在数据驱动的时代,MDF与LDF文件的自动备份不仅是技术层面的要求,更是企业生存和发展的战略考量
通过科学合理的备份策略,结合先进的技术手段,我们可以有效抵御数据丢失的风险,确保业务的连续性和数据的完整性
同时,这也要求企业不断审视和更新其数据保护策略,以适应不断变化的威胁环境和业务需求
总之,自动备份机制是数据安全的基石,而MDF与LDF文件的妥善保护则是这一基石中的核心
让我们携手努力,构建更加坚固的数据安全防线,为企业的发展保驾护航
SQL2008降级:备份数据库全攻略
SQL导入Oracle备份,数据库恢复指南
mdf与ldf文件的自动数据库备份
高效实现数据库远程备份策略
邮箱服务器备份全攻略
网易企业邮箱:轻松实现自主备份指南
RMAN日备份:确保数据库安全无忧
网站数据库备份文件夹管理指南
MySQL数据库备份:.sql文件的重要性
SQL2005:如何删除数据库备份文件
U8数据库备份文件:安全存储指南
CentOS数据库备份文件位置指南
高效备份服务器文件必备技巧
FileGee企业备份:高效文件守护方案
企业文件同步备份:高效数据安全方案
数据库备份:为何文件保护至关重要
SQL文件备份:数据库导出全攻略
打造高效企业数据防线:揭秘文件备份服务器的重要性
如何打开数据库.bak备份文件教程